第二十七章 SQL命令 DELETE(一) 从表中删除行。 DELETE [%keyword] [FROM] table-ref [[AS] t-alias] [FROM [optimize-option] select-table [[AS] t-alias] {,select-table2 [[AS] t-alias]} ] [WHERE condition-expression] DELETE [%keyword] [FROM] table-ref [[AS] t-alias] [WHERE CURRE...
• 不支持DELETE语句中使用LIMIT。应使用WHERE条件明确需要更新的目标行。 • 不支持在单条SQL语句中,对多个表进行删除。 • DELETE语句中必须有WHERE子句,避免全表扫描。 • DELETE语句中禁止不应使用ORDER BY、GROUP BY子句,避免不必要的排序。 • 如果需要清空一张表,建议使用TRUNCATE,而不是DELETE。 ...
- LIMIT:限制一次性删除的数据行数。 总结: DELETE语句是SQL中用于删除表中数据的关键字。通过指定表名和删除条件,可以删除符合条件的数据。但需要注意的是,删除操作是不可逆转的,务必在操作前备份重要数据。另外,还可以使用其他SQL关键字和语法来增强和控制删除操作的方式。©...
SQL中的DELETE语句可以用来删除数据表中的行记录。 01 语法结构 DELETE FROM table_name [WHERE clause] 根据语法结构中是否有WHERE子句,DELETE语句删除数据主要有以下两种形式: 02 实例 2.1 删除指定行数据 比如:删除2.3节<插入数据 – INSERT语句>中插入的记录,即删除product_id = 'testP'的记录: DELETE FROM ...
1 delete语句介绍 语句用于删除表中已经存在的 整行 数据。基本语法如下: 关键词代表删除数据的目标表 子句代表被删除数据的满足条件,如果没有 子句则代表所有表数据都删除 子句代表删除数据的顺序 子句代表被删除数据的 行数限制 关键词表示删除语句需要等待其他链接的读
今天是SQL课程的第十课。 讲讲DELETE 删除语句,用来删除表中的一条或多条记录。 基本语法: DELETE FROM <表名> WHERE <筛选条件>; 1. 1、DELETE语句 如果省略WHERE条件,这时候DELETE就会删除整个表的记录。 注意:这里不是删除表,只是删除表中所有数据,还会保留表结构的。
今天是SQL课程的第十课。 讲讲DELETE 删除语句,用来删除表中的一条或多条记录。 基本语法: DELETE FROM <表名> WHERE <筛选条件>; 1、DELETE语句 如果省略WHERE条件,这时候DELETE就会删除整个表的记录。 注意:这里不是删除表,只是删除表中所有数据,还会保留表结构的。 实例:删除Teachers表中所有记录。 DELETE ...
delete 语句每次删除一行,并在事务日志中为所删除的每行记录一项。所以可以对delete操作进行roll back 1、truncate 在各种表上无论是大的还是小的都非常快。如果有ROLLBACK命令Delete将被撤销,而 truncate 则不会被撤销。 2、truncate 是一个DDL语言,向其他所有的DDL语言一样,他将被隐式提交,不能对 truncate 使...
SQL编程之道6.3 删除数据——DELETE语句,本视频由码农老关提供,0次播放,好看视频是由百度团队打造的集内涵和颜值于一身的专业短视频聚合平台
1 语法一:按条件删除数据DELETE FROM 表名称 WHERE 列名称 = 值 2 以简单的学生表举列:学生有姓名(name)和年龄(age)两列 3 查询张三SELECT * FROM student WHERE `name` = '张三'删除学生张三DELETE FROM student WHERE `name` = '张三'4 语法二:删除所有行(可以在不删除表的...